The advent of this century has seen the development and eventual evolution of bathroom lights. Nowadays, we can find various elegant and energy-saving appliances, and the bathroom lightings are not an exception. If ever you decide to upgrade your bathroom lighting, do take into consideration the size of the bathroom. At least two lighting options in an average bathroom is an applicable rule.

The sink and the mirror area should have their own lighting. The lighting style during the seventies was either a series of bare light bulbs circling around the mirror, or a bar of fluorescent light. The amount of lights was necessary because women apply make-up at that area and as such, good lighting is a must. Nowadays, women do not wear as much make-up. With this in mind, illumination around the mirror and sink areas can be toned down somewhat, and that means doing away with the garish light bulbs.

You also have to think the placing of the lights. You will probably find that in most homes, there is a highly illuminated mirror area, and a singular light on a ceiling to light up the toilet and the bathtub. The types of light that are used for this purpose are usually high-powered, and tend to wear themselves out after only a number of months. A good energy-saving alternative would be sconces attached to walls.

There are so many designs, colors, and make to choose from. With just a little imagination, the lighting fixtures can be put together to compose a theme. This means that you can actually make your bathroom look like one that you can find in English inns, completes with rich wood materials and bulbs. If you desire, you can also lighting the bathroom per section using canister lighting. If you use the toilet only for to take a dump, you may do away with lights the mirror area.

You will also have to check your light bulbs as they, too, can spell a difference. Go purchase a white light bulb with a high wattage if you are gunning for intensely bright light. You can save a good deal of energy and money from using light bulbs that are made specifically to save energy. You can find them even in the regular light bulb section. Although they are priced higher than the regular light bulb, energy saving bulbs last a lot longer, up to ten times as much.

The primary thing that you have to consider is your satisfaction with the kind of lighting that you have at present. You might probably want to replace your built-in fluorescent light bulbs with better-designed lamps. Installing energy- saving bulbs will help you save energy and money on your electric bill. Aside from this, you can have a crisper, more natural-looking light.

Contemporary bathrooms make use of the more advanced lighting designs such as multiple bulb fixtures that are usually installed at the sink area. These fixtures give more than ample light for the bathroom. A dimmer may also be bought, which is useful specifically when you want less light in instances such as using the bathroom late at night when everyone is asleep.

Always remember that, whenever you search for bathroom lighting fixtures, their placement is just as important as the type of light that you intend to buy. The location of the lighting fixtures makes a lot of difference in carrying out activities such as applying cosmetics. Oftentimes, light that comes directly overhead is not ideal, and to get optimum lighting the bulb fixtures are better placed on the side, or just above the sink. These lighting positions also improve the overall look of the bathroom.
